=Just His Luck.= By OLIVER OPTIC. Illustrated. $1.00.
"It deals with real flesh and blood boys; with
boys who possess many noble qualities of mind;
with boys of generous impulses and large
hearts; with boys who delight in playing
pranks, and who are ever ready for any sort of
mischief; and with boys in whom human nature is
strongly engrafted. They are boys, as many of
us have been; boys in the true, unvarnished
sense of the word; boys with hopes, ideas, and
inspirations, but lacking in judgment,
self-control, and discipline. And the book
contains an appropriate moral, teaches many a
lesson, and presents many a precept worthy of
being followed. It is a capital book for boys."

=A Start in Life=: A STORY OF THE GENESEE COUNTRY. By J. T. TROWBRIDGE.
Illustrated. $1.00.
In this story the author recounts the hardships
of a young lad in his first endeavor to start
out for himself. It is a tale that is full of
enthusiasm and budding hopes. The writer shows
how hard the youths of a century ago were
compelled to work. This he does in an
entertaining way, mingling fun and adventures
with their daily labors. The hero is a striking
example of the honest boy, who is not too lazy
to work, nor too dull to thoroughly appreciate
a joke.
